The ER Manager will play a pivotal role in fostering a positive work environment within the organisation, ensuring smooth communication and resolving conflicts effectively. This role will oversee and implement policies and programmes that impact the employee life cycle. Additionally, the role will ensure compliance with employment law and regulations.
Support with the implementation of the UK Employee Relations strategy, policy, framework and procedures.
- Lead and manage complex employee relations cases across multiple locations, ensuring consistency, fairness, and legal compliance.
- Provide expert guidance on disciplinary, grievance, absence management, and performance issues.
- Lead and develop an ER team, setting clear objectives and supporting professional growth.
- Partner with senior stakeholders and HR colleagues to proactively address workforce challenges and reduce ER risk.
- Maintain and develop effective working relationships across the UK workforce.
- Analyse ER trends and metrics to identify patterns and implement preventative strategies.
- Internal contact for employment law queries.
- Manage the relationship with our retained employment law partner, reviewing performance and service provision.
- Drive and manage ER projects.
- Build capability by working with Senior HR BP’s, People Managers and L&D to ensure appropriate training and support is provided.
- Provide data on key KPI’s for the HR team.
- Support organisational change initiatives, including restructures and consultations.
- Ensure policies and procedures are up to date and aligned with best practice and employment legislation.
